Discover Computing with DPI Fall and Winter

Discovery Partners Institute

Discover Computing is a two-part program series designed to build a deeper and more diverse pool of students pursuing computer science and tech-related fields of study in Illinois. Students will work with DPI staff, Google mentors, and Wright College near peer mentors.

In the first installment, participating 9th and 10th graders engage in hands-on sessions to explore computing concepts and tools, including web development using HTML/CSS, machine learning using Python, and data analysis, as well as develop skills in problem-solving and team-building through design thinking activities.

In the second installment of this two-part series, Discover Computing 2, participating 9th and 10th graders engage in hands-on sessions to explore creative computing concepts and tools, including using code to create interactive murals, make logos, and more, as well as develop skills in problem-solving and team-building through design thinking activities.
